Post-Workout Fuel : The Perfect Protein Blend for Muscles

After a strenuous workout, your muscles need the optimal fuel to regrow. A protein supplement is essential for fulfilling these needs and helping you achieve your fitness goals. A well-formulated post-workout protein blend should contain a variety of sources of protein to provide a complete amino acid profile. This ensures muscle growth and helps reduce muscle soreness.

Whey protein, derived from milk, is a popular choice due to its fast absorption rate. It's perfect for post-workout recovery as it delivers amino acids to your muscles quickly. Casein protein, also from milk, digests more slowly and provides a sustained release of amino acids, making it helpful for overnight muscle recovery.

Including plant-based proteins like soy, pea, or brown rice protein can further enhance your blend's nutritional value and cater to dietary needs. Look for a post-workout protein blend that is low in sugar and fat, and contains additional ingredients like BCAAs, glutamine, or electrolytes to maximize your recovery process.

Unlock Your Power: The Power of Whey, Casein, and Plant-Based Proteins

Pursue your fitness goals with the power of protein! Whether you're a seasoned athlete or just starting your fitness journey, incorporating the best proteins into your diet can make a significant difference. Whey protein, a quick-acting choice, is great for post-workout recovery, helping to restore muscle tissue and promote gains. Casein protein, on the other hand, provides long-lasting fuel throughout the night, making it a excellent option for bedtime or extended periods without food. For those following a plant-based lifestyle, there are plenty of mouthwatering plant-based protein options available, such as soy, pea, and brown rice protein.

These alternatives offer a wholesome way to fuel your body and achieve your fitness aspirations. Remember to consult with a healthcare professional or registered dietitian to determine the appropriate protein intake for your individual needs and goals.

The Science Behind Muscle Growth: How Protein Powders Work

When it comes to building muscle, protein plays a vital role. Our muscles are made up of amino acids that constantly break down themselves. To stimulate muscle growth, we need to consume more protein than our bodies destroy. This is where protein powders prove helpful.

Protein powders offer a highly concentrated source of amino acids, making it an efficient way to boost your protein intake. They are often sourced from milk proteins, plant-based sources, various combinations. Each type has its own benefits, so choosing the right product depends on your individual goals.

In addition to providing protein, some protein powders also contain essential nutrients. This can be beneficial for athletes or people following a limited diet.

Nevertheless, it's important to remember that protein powder is not a magic bullet. To gain muscle growth, you also need to participate in strength training. Combining proper nutrition with a well-structured workout routine will help you reach your fitness goals.

Choosing the right protein powder can be daunting with so many options available. Therefore, knowing what to look for ensures you're getting a high-quality product that meets your needs.

One crucial factor is the presence of essential amino acids. These are the building blocks for protein that our bodies cannot produce on their own, meaning we must obtain them through our diet or supplements.

A complete protein powder contains all nine essential amino acids in sufficient quantities. Look for powders featuring isoleucine, leucine, lysine, methionine, phenylalanine, threonine, tryptophan, valine, and histidine on the label.

These amino acids play vital roles in tissue growth and repair, hormone production, immune function, and more. Opting for a protein powder rich in these essential nutrients will help you maximize your fitness goals and overall health.
